首页 > 其他分享 >[转]为什么VS提示SurfFeatureDetector不是cv的成员函数

[转]为什么VS提示SurfFeatureDetector不是cv的成员函数

时间:2022-10-07 22:14:59浏览次数:95  
标签:头文件 lib SurfFeatureDetector opencv VS include cv

surf和sift算法都是在头文件#include <opencv2/features2d/features2d.hpp>中,但在新的opencv版本出来后,如果仍然使用这个头文件就会出现编译错误如下: 'SurfFeatureDetector' : is not a member of 'cv'

原因:没有把 opencv_nonfree243d.lib 加入lib库中。

还有两个头文件:

#include <opencv2/nonfree/features2d.hpp>
#include <opencv2/nonfree/nonfree.hpp>

出现这种问题的时候,主要是没有把相关的头文件include进去,还有就是相关的lib没有添加。

 

————————————————
版权声明:本文为CSDN博主「Lin-JM」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/linj_m/article/details/11883041

标签:头文件,lib,SurfFeatureDetector,opencv,VS,include,cv
From: https://www.cnblogs.com/rainbow70626/p/16767278.html

相关文章